Merge lp:~ubuntu-mate-dev/indicator-session/mate-compatibility into lp:indicator-session

Proposed by Martin Wimpress 
Status: Merged
Approved by: Sebastien Bacher
Approved revision: 472
Merged at revision: 473
Proposed branch: lp:~ubuntu-mate-dev/indicator-session/mate-compatibility
Merge into: lp:indicator-session
Diff against target: 17 lines (+3/-3)
1 file modified
debian/control (+3/-3)
To merge this branch: bzr merge lp:~ubuntu-mate-dev/indicator-session/mate-compatibility
Reviewer Review Type Date Requested Status
Martin Pitt Approve
Indicator Applet Developers Pending
Review via email:

Commit message

list extra recommends alternatives to gnome components

Description of the change

MATE proxies or shares the GNOME namespaces for session management. indicator-session is therefore MATE compatible without requiring any code changes.

This merge proposal adds mate-control-center to the Recommends: to prevent unnecessary Unity or GNOME components being seeded in Ubuntu MATE.

Revision history for this message
Martin Pitt (pitti) wrote :

LGTM, thanks!

review: Approve
Revision history for this message
Martin Pitt (pitti) wrote :

dput into yakkety. I cannot merge this as ~ubuntu-core-dev does not have access to the branch, and the CI train barfs because the previous version in yakkety hasn't been applied to the branch either.

Preview Diff

1=== modified file 'debian/control'
2--- debian/control 2016-03-15 14:33:29 +0000
3+++ debian/control 2016-06-13 12:40:30 +0000
4@@ -27,10 +27,10 @@
5 gnome-settings-daemon-schemas,
6 gsettings-desktop-schemas,
7 Recommends: indicator-applet (>= 0.2) | indicator-renderer,
8- gnome-screensaver,
9+ gnome-screensaver | mate-screensaver,
10 yelp,
11- unity-control-center | gnome-control-center,
12- unity-control-center-signon | gnome-control-center-signon
13+ unity-control-center | gnome-control-center | mate-control-center,
14+ unity-control-center-signon | gnome-control-center-signon | mate-control-center,
15 Suggests: lightdm,
16 apport,
17 zenity


